The technical scope handled by a Level 2 Electrician North Shore is divided into numerous specialised classifications that a general tradesperson merely can not perform by law. This includes Class 2A disconnections and reconnections, which are necessary for security when carrying out major structural renovations or throughout the demolition of an old home. They likewise specialise in Class 2B underground services, laying the high-capacity customer mains that keep modern developments visually tidy and protected from the components. For properties in more standard pockets,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ore manages Class 2C overhead services, which involves the installation and maintenance of private power poles and the crucial point of accessory where the street mains meet your roofline. In addition, their Class 2D accreditation covers advanced metering jobs, allowing them to install the wise meters necessary for tracking solar energy exports or transitioning to more cost-effective time-of-use electricity tariffs.
Homeowners on the North Shore often require the services of a qualified Level 2 Electrician to resolve electrical concerns determined by Ausgrid, typically following a regular evaluation that reveals a prospective security risk. Typical problems include deteriorating power poles, drooping wires, and outdated electrical panels that stop working to satisfy existing security standards. As these concerns are related to the external network, just a certified Level 2 Electrician is authorized to remedy the problem and supply the required compliance accreditation to resolve the issue. Stopping working to resolve these notices can lead to the interruption of electrical service, but a competent and proactive Level 2 specialist can quickly restore compliance, leveraging their thorough knowledge of the regional network's specific requirements to deliver effective and long-lasting repair work that can stand up to the region's severe coastal conditions.
The demand for high-power appliances is increasing, leading to the expansion of the Level 2 Electrician North Shore's responsibilities in home modernization and future-proofing. Older homes in locations like Lindfield or Roseville were originally developed with single-phase power, which may not suffice for the electricity needs more info of contemporary living, such as fast electrical vehicle battery chargers, effective cooling, and induction cooktops. A Level 2 Electrician North Shore is the sole professional authorized to upgrade a home's power to three-phase, tripling its electrical capacity. This upgrade procedure consists of changing service merges, setting up new consumer mains, and making sure the switchboard can handle the greater current. By investing in these upgrades, you boost the reliability of your daily power supply, boost the marketplace worth, and extend the practical lifespan of your property in North Shore, Australia.
